Notes
General Note
Originally produced as a motion picture in 1985.
General Note
Special features: disc 1. new restoration supervised by director James Ivory and cinematographer Tony Pierce-Roberts; commentary from Simon Callow, Ismail Merchant, James Ivory and Tony Pierce-Roberts; disc 2. archive promotional appearances by Daniel Day-Lewis and Simon Callow; BBC report on the film's success in the U.S.; E.M. Forster remembered; film scrapbook with never-before-seen photos and memorabilia; Merchant Ivory tribute.
Participants/Performers
Maggie Smith, Helena Bonham-Carter, Denholm Elliott, Julian Sands, Simon Callow, Patrick Godfrey, Judi Dench, Fabia Drake, Joan Henley, Amanda Walker, Daniel Day-Lewis, Maria Britneva, Rosemary Leach, Rupert Graves, Peter Cellier, Mia Fothergill.
Description
Based on the novel by E.M. Forster.
Description
In the early 1900's, upper-class Lucy Honeychurch must wrestle with her inner romantic longings to choose between passionate and free-spirited George, or priggish but socially suitable Cecil.
